Weight Care, Without The Clinic

CareWell Health offers remote wellness consulting that focuses on lifestyle, not prescriptions. We blend evidence-informed guidance, practical tools, and weekly check-ins to help you reshape habits, honor your body, and create weight goals that feel humane and sustainable.

Method

Together we explore sleep, movement, meals, stress, and environment, then design small experiments you can actually live with. No fad diets, just practical coaching, reflection, and steady support to help progress stick.
